About the Role The Company is seeking a VP of Product Management to play a pivotal role in defining and leading the strategy for enterprise customers, with a focus on elevating customer experiences and building new capabilities to support modern work execution. This senior leadership position involves deep market understanding, creating a compelling product vision, and working closely with cross-functional teams to ensure successful go-to-market strategies. The successful candidate will be responsible for managing a large team and must have a proven track record of at least 15 years in product management, particularly in software products, and extensive experience as a people manager. Experience in enterprise administration, developer or partner ecosystems, and a strong commitment to customer needs and team collaboration are essential. The role also requires a passion for web-based business software, the ability to evaluate technical concepts, and experience with data analytics and visualization.The ideal candidate for the VP of Product Management role at the company will be a strategic leader with a customer-centric approach, a passion for innovation, and an extraordinary ability to communicate with stakeholders at all levels. They will be expected to manage a team of product managers, define product roadmaps, and work closely with design and engineering to deliver high-quality customer experiences. The role demands a candidate with a deep understanding of B2B or B2C cloud environments and a proven ability to analyze market trends to make informed decisions. A background in enterprise decision-making, including areas such as manageability, data governance, data integrations, and developer ecosystems, is highly valued.
